When sourcing a Car Audio DSP, you must prioritize the number of input and output channels (e.g., 6-in/8-out or 8-in/12-out) to ensure compatibility with the vehicle's speaker configuration. Look for a high Sampling Rate (at least 96kHz/24-bit) for high-resolution audio processing. Additionally, verify the Signal-to-Noise Ratio (SNR); professional-grade units should exceed 100dB to ensure minimal background hiss. Check for integrated High-Level inputs with auto-turn-on functions, which are essential for integrating with modern OEM factory head units.
The hardware is only as good as its software. Ensure the supplier provides a user-friendly PC tuning interface and, ideally, a mobile app (iOS/Android) via Bluetooth. Key software features should include a 31-band Parametric EQ (PEQ) per channel, Time Alignment with increments as small as 0.02ms, and adjustable Crossover slopes (Linkwitz-Riley or Butterworth) ranging from 6dB to 48dB/octave. Request a demo version of the software before purchasing to test stability and feature depth.
To ensure smooth customs clearance and consumer safety, products must carry CE (Europe) and FCC (USA) certifications. Since these devices are installed in vehicles, E-Mark (E11/E13) certification is highly recommended for the European automotive market. Furthermore, ensure the product complies with RoHS (Restriction of Hazardous Substances) and that the internal power supply has over-voltage and thermal protection to prevent vehicle electrical fires.
A standalone DSP only processes the signal and requires external amplifiers to drive speakers, offering the highest audio fidelity for competition-grade systems. A DSP Amplifier combines processing and power amplification in one chassis, which is more cost-effective and space-saving for retail consumers. For B2B buyers, stocking both types is recommended, but DSP Amplifiers currently see higher demand in the aftermarket due to easier installation.
Implement a strict Quality Control (QC) protocol by hiring a third-party inspection service to perform a Function Test on 5-10% of the batch before shipment. Specifically, ask them to test the stability of the Bluetooth connection and the output voltage consistency. Focus on long-term scalability rather than just the initial unit price. Negotiate for customized firmware (OEM) that includes your brand logo in the software interface, which increases brand loyalty. Ask for a 1-2% spare parts allowance (extra units or components) instead of a price discount to cover potential RMA (Return Merchandise Authorization) issues, as shipping single defective units back to China is not cost-effective.
Car DSPs contain sensitive capacitors and IC chips. Ensure the supplier uses anti-static packaging and double-walled corrugated export cartons with foam inserts. For shipping to the US or Europe, use DDP (Delivered Duty Paid) terms if you want the supplier to handle all customs duties, but FOB (Free On Board) is generally preferred for experienced buyers to maintain control over freight costs and transit times.
